Hurricanes Announce 2022-2023 Promo Schedule

Published on October 25, 2022 under Western Hockey League (WHL)
Lethbridge Hurricanes News Release


LETHBRIDGE, AB - The Lethbridge Hurricanes Hockey Club announced Tuesday the promotion schedule for the 2022- 2023 regular season, including the 26th Annual Canadian Tire Teddy and Toque Toss.

The Hurricanes will hold the annual Toque and Teddy Toss on Friday, December 9th when they welcome the Medicine Hat Tigers to the ENMAX Centre. Bears and toques collected during the annual game go to support organizations around Southern Alberta, including the Chinook Regional Hospital, Lethbridge Family Services, Blood Tribe Emergency Services and many more. Tickets for the Toque and Teddy Toss will be available at both Canadian Tire locations beginning on November 1st, 2022. With a $15 purchase of a bear or toque, fans will receive a free ticket to the game, while quantities last.

Other important promotion game dates include:

October 29th vs. Saskatoon Blades - B-93 Halloween Howler

November 9th vs. Prince Albert Raiders - Lethbridge Herald Military Appreciation Night

December 17th vs. Calgary Hitmen - Tim Hortons Santa & Ugly Christmas Sweater Night

February 1st vs. Moose Jaw Warriors - TELUS #EndBullying Night

February 17th vs. Brandon Wheat Kings - Copperwood Family Night

March 17th vs. Calgary Hitmen - ENMAX Fan Appreciation Night

March 24th vs. Red Deer Rebels - ATB Financial Awards & Jersey's Off Our Backs

The Hurricanes welcome the Saskatoon Blades on B-93 Halloween Howler Night on Saturday, October 29th. Fans are encouraged to wear their costumes and prizes will be awarded to best costumes for adults and youth. Kids can also "trick-or-treat" at the ENMAX Centre concessions and 50/50 booths.
